Biotin - Glucagon - Like Peptide 1, GLP - 1 (7 - 36), amide (human)

Description:

This GLP-1 (7-36) amide, is labeled with biotin at the peptide N-terminus. GLP-1 (7-36) amide is an incretin hormone that causes glucose dependent release of insulin by pancreatic beta cells.

Sequence:

Biotin-HAEGTFTSDVSSYLEGQAAKEFIAWLVKGR-NH2
